noun, feminine/kɑ̃.ti.te ne.ɡli.ʒabl/plural: quantités négligeables
something that doesn't enter the equation, something or someone that is deemed negligible, i.e. so insignificant that it or they can be ignored
“tenir quelqu'un en quantité négligeable, tenir quelqu'un comme quantité négligeable” — to not take someone and their opinion into account, to disregard someone and ignore their opinion
Literally, “negligible quantity”. Compare English unknown quantity.
